Output 507aa0e63e3604c1df7ca85905973bb70143384e5771cec7087ce2c9dc721a05:66

value
24525
script pubkey
OP_0 OP_PUSHBYTES_20 3ac93968886570e1b0d407eb30ec0c9d1712e2b7
address
bc1q8tynj6ygv4cwrvx5ql4npmqvn5t39c4hx6hzvy
transaction
507aa0e63e3604c1df7ca85905973bb70143384e5771cec7087ce2c9dc721a05
spent
true